Ok now, I was able to get things moving now am stucked with the blogger custom domain settings. After redirecting it to my blog, anytime I open the blog, it won't bring any error page, just a blank page. I tried switching back to the default blog sub-domain url, the thing tends to work for like an hour and then I displays an error 404 page, any solution? |
| Re: Help- Domain Redirection Problem by Nobody: 8:34am On Jul 16, 2012 |
It has to do with your CNAME and A. You have to enter googles i.p address to the DNS and also change your CNAME. The i.p addresses are 4 in number. |
